Flow Visualized: The Art & Utility of Sankey’s Streamlined Storytelling

Flow Visualized: The Art & Utility of Sankey’s Streamlined Storytelling

Imagine data and energy as fluid stories with their own movements and meanings, tracing paths through complex systems. This is the world of Sankey diagrams, powerful visual tools that offer a unique way of illuminating the flow of things. In this article, we delve into the creation of Sankey charts, their applications, and why they’re becoming an essential part of modern data storytelling.

The Genesis of the Sankey Diagram

Sankey diagrams are named after English engineer William D. F. Sankey, who patented the concept in 1898. Sankey’s diagram depicted the energy flow in a steam engine. This flow is illustrated as arrows that expand and contract according to the amount of material or energy being conveyed. Sankey diagrams are often described as a ‘storytelling device’ because they are able to convey large amounts of data in an intuitive and visually appealing way.

Key Characteristics of Sankey Diagrams

The defining features of Sankey diagrams include:

  • Energy or Material Flow: They depict the flow of materials, energy, or costs through a process or system.
  • Magnitude Representation: The width of each arrow increases as the amount of material, energy, or cash entering and leaving a part of the system grows, creating an intuitive representation of the relative magnitude of flows.
  • Energy Efficiency: They typically use flow width to indicate the efficiency of processes since a wider arrow path represents more efficient energy use and less waste.

Creating Sankey Diagrams

Creating a Sankey diagram requires a few steps:

1. Gather Data

Collect data on the flow of energy, materials, or money through the system you want to represent. Understand the inputs, processes, and outputs in your network.

2. Identify Nodes and Links

Identify the nodes, which are the individual components, and the links, which describe the relationships between nodes and the amount of flow between them.

3. Choose Software or Tools

There are several tools available for creating Sankey diagrams, from simple free online generators to dedicated software. Common tools include Sankey.js, Gephi, Matplotlib, and Sigma.js. Choose a tool that fits your data requirements and your design aesthetic.

4. Map Data to Nodes and Links

Use your data to define the nodes and links on your diagram. Assign values to each link that reflect the volume of flow and use these to set the width of the arrows.

5. Customize the Design

Tailor the design to enhance story readability. This could include selecting a color scheme that aligns with your brand or the context of the data, adding labels for clarity, and experimenting with font styles and sizes.

Applications of Sankey Diagrams

Sankey diagrams are employed in a variety of fields for their ability to visualize complex data:

1. Energy Systems

They are widely used in the energy sector to show the energy conversion and losses within power plants and to illustrate the energy flow in buildings.

2. Environmental Studies

Sankey diagrams help to model the flow of pollutants in ecosystems, showing how materials enter, circulate, and leave the system.

3. Business and Economics

These diagrams showcase the flow of goods, money, and information in businesses, providing a clear picture of an organization’s financial flows or the movement of products.

4. IT Systems

In IT, they can visualize the flow of data or the efficiency of computing systems, helping to pinpoint bottlenecks.

5. Urban Planning

Sankey diagrams are used in transportation planning to illustrate and understand the flows of passengers and vehicles.

Concluding Thoughts

Sankey diagrams are a unique storytelling method for illustrating the movement and conversion of energy, material, costs, and more within a system. Their artistry lies in simplifying complex systems to enhance understanding. As data science permeates more aspects of daily life, the utilization of Sankey diagrams in data visualization will continue to grow. For those looking to present data with a story and a point of view rather than merely numerical data, Sankey diagrams stand out as a powerful and elegant solution.

SankeyMaster

S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.

S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.
SankeyMaster - Unleash the Power of Sankey Diagrams on iOS and macOS.
SankeyMaster is your essential tool for crafting sophisticated Sankey diagrams on both iOS and macOS. Effortlessly input data and create intricate Sankey diagrams that unveil complex data relationships with precision.